+/* Calls cpuid with an eax of 'ax' and returns the 16 bytes in *p
+ * We are compiled with -fPIC, so we can't clobber ebx.
+ */
+static inline void do_x86cpuid(unsigned int ax, unsigned int *p)
+{
+#ifdef __i386__
+ __asm__("pushl %%ebx\n\t"
+ "cpuid\n\t"
+ "movl %%ebx, %%esi\n\t"
+ "popl %%ebx"
+ : "=a" (p[0]), "=S" (p[1]), "=c" (p[2]), "=d" (p[3])
+ : "0" (ax));
+#endif
+}
+
+/* From xf86info havecpuid.c 1.11 */
+static inline int have_x86cpuid(void)
+{
+#ifdef __i386__
+ unsigned int f1, f2;
+ __asm__("pushfl\n\t"
+ "pushfl\n\t"
+ "popl %0\n\t"
+ "movl %0,%1\n\t"
+ "xorl %2,%0\n\t"
+ "pushl %0\n\t"
+ "popfl\n\t"
+ "pushfl\n\t"
+ "popl %0\n\t"
+ "popfl"
+ : "=&r" (f1), "=&r" (f2)
+ : "ir" (0x00200000));
+ return ((f1^f2) & 0x00200000) != 0;
+#else
+ return 0;
+#endif
+}
